BMW 3 Series320i M Sport 5dr Step Auto20264,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£527.82, Customer Deposit: £5,999.00, Total Deposit: £6,499.25, Optional Final Payment: £18,729.36, Total Charge For Credit: £10,041.15, Total Amount Payable: £50,036.15,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 13.26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 5dr Step Auto20264,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£472.22, Customer Deposit: £5,549.00, Total Deposit: £6,049.25, Optional Final Payment: £18,183.85, Total Charge For Credit: £9,432.44, Total Amount Payable: £46,427.44,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 13.26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20264,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£488.70, Customer Deposit: £5,474.00, Total Deposit: £5,974.25, Optional Final Payment: £16,623.09, Total Charge For Credit: £9,071.24, Total Amount Payable: £45,566.24,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.13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e 22.3 kWh M Sport 4dr Step Auto20254,000 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£610.97, Customer Deposit: £6,449.00, Total Deposit: £6,949.25, Optional Final Payment: £17,702.17, Total Charge For Credit: £10,372.01, Total Amount Payable: £53,367.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.04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e 22.3 kWh M Sport 4dr Step Auto20254,000 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£565.36, Customer Deposit: £6,134.00, Total Deposit: £6,634.25, Optional Final Payment: £17,702.17, Total Charge For Credit: £10,013.34, Total Amount Payable: £50,908.34,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.04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20254,690 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£417.18, Customer Deposit: £4,949.00, Total Deposit: £5,449.25, Optional Final Payment: £16,366.16, Total Charge For Credit: £8,427.87, Total Amount Payable: £41,422.87,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.54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320d MHT M Sport 4dr Step Auto202317,571 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£471.55, Customer Deposit: £4,499.00, Total Deposit: £4,999.25, Optional Final Payment: £13,004.11, Total Charge For Credit: £10,171.21, Total Amount Payable: £40,166.21,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.46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 5dr Step Auto20263,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£491.72, Customer Deposit: £5,696.00, Total Deposit: £6,196.25, Optional Final Payment: £18,286.08, Total Charge For Credit: £9,618.17, Total Amount Payable: £47,593.17,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 13.26ppm, Mileage Per Annum: 10,000Read more
BMW 3 SeriesM340i xDrive MHT 392 5dr Step Auto20263,000 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£858.69, Customer Deposit: £8,966.00, Total Deposit: £9,466.25, Optional Final Payment: £24,366.41, Total Charge For Credit: £14,416.09, Total Amount Payable: £74,191.09,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 16.37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20265,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£555.06, Customer Deposit: £5,921.00, Total Deposit: £6,421.25, Optional Final Payment: £16,529.61, Total Charge For Credit: £9,563.68, Total Amount Payable: £49,038.68,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.13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20263,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£586.44, Customer Deposit: £6,221.00, Total Deposit: £6,721.25, Optional Final Payment: £17,218.07, Total Charge For Credit: £10,027.00, Total Amount Payable: £51,502.00,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.13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20255,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£497.21, Customer Deposit: £5,546.00, Total Deposit: £6,046.25, Optional Final Payment: £16,732.34, Total Charge For Credit: £9,172.46, Total Amount Payable: £46,147.46,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.90ppm, Mileage Per Annum: 10,000Read more
BMW 3 SeriesM340i xDrive MHT 4dr Step Auto20256,000 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£730.08, Customer Deposit: £8,006.00, Total Deposit: £8,506.25, Optional Final Payment: £23,773.14, Total Charge For Credit: £13,218.15, Total Amount Payable: £66,593.15,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 16.14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to202318,724 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£439.81, Customer Deposit: £4,331.00, Total Deposit: £4,831.25, Optional Final Payment: £13,358.24, Total Charge For Credit: £9,985.56, Total Amount Payable: £38,860.56,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 9.72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i xDrive M Sport 4dr Step Auto202227,598 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£407.65, Customer Deposit: £3,881.00, Total Deposit: £4,381.25, Optional Final Payment: £11,049.10, Total Charge For Credit: £8,714.90, Total Amount Payable: £34,589.90,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 7.58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i M Sport 4dr Step Auto20256,000 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£557.70, Customer Deposit: £5,924.00, Total Deposit: £6,424.25, Optional Final Payment: £16,403.86, Total Charge For Credit: £9,545.01, Total Amount Payable: £49,040.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.54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series320i Sport 4dr Step Auto202337,060 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£386.44, Customer Deposit: £3,712.00, Total Deposit: £4,212.50, Optional Final Payment: £10,746.95, Total Charge For Credit: £8,372.13, Total Amount Payable: £33,122.13, Representative APR: 13.90%, Interest Rate (Fixed): 13.90%, Excess Mileage Charge: 8.34ppm, Mileage Per Annum: 10,000Read more